Definition: Gigabit

The gigabit is a multiple of the unit bit for digital information or computer storage.

1 gigabit = 1,000,000,000 bits.

Note that the official SI definition uses the "gibibit" or Gib unit to represent 230 bits.


Definition: Milligigabit

The SI prefix "milli" represents a factor of 10-3, or in exponential notation, 1E-3.

So 1 milligigabit = 10-3 gigabits.
